It is the eighth most successful video game franchise in history

Tetris was the first entertainment software to be imported from the former Soviet Union into the United States. Ever since, Tetris has sold over 200 million copies, making it the eighth most successful video game franchise in history. It has more units sold than HALO and Minecraft combined. And according to the Guinness Book of World Records, it is the most ported, or adapted, game in history, appearing on more than 65 platforms, including desktop computers, gaming consoles, mobile phones, and even graphing calculators.

It may reduce cravings for food and adult beverages

Scientists have found that playing Tetris may reduce cravings for food, and other things that might lead to abuse. A research study in Australia had students carry old-school iPods around campus for a week. The students received seven text messages a day asking them to report how badly they wanted to eat, sleep, smoke cigarettes, or even do other things. Half of the students were asked to play Tetris, and the researchers found that the students that played Tetris for at least three minutes were able to manage their cravings more than the students that didn’t play Tetris. It can also help with mental disorders such as post-traumatic stress disorder, in addition to assisting with brain growth and developing skills in problem-solving and maturity.

The game and its music are highly addictive

Most Tetris players can spend three hours playing the game without realizing it. Even the famous actor Jackie Chan is a victim. He said he had to stop playing Tetris because it started to interfere with his work. It is ranked as the world’s third most addictive video game. Even Apple’s co-founder Steve Wozniak is a Tetris addict, and had the highest score ever for a time. The background music is addictive as well, and many publications have ranked it in the top ten game soundtracks.

It was the first video game to be played in outer space

In 1993, the Russian space station Mir orbited the earth 3,000 times spending 196 days in space. Tetris was the game they played while in space, and when they landed back on Earth, the Game Boy they used while in orbit along with the Tetris game they played, was auctioned off for $1,200. Tetris is still being played to this day, and has secured its place in the hall of fame of gaming.
